174.22
18 - when epoll detects unremovable fds in the fd set, rebuild
19 only the epoll descriptor, not the signal pipe, to avoid
20 SIGPIPE in ev_async_send. This doesn't solve it on fork,
21 so document what needs to be done in ev_loop_fork
22 (analyzed by Benjamin Mahler).
23 - remove superfluous sys/timeb.h include on win32
24 (analyzed by Jason Madden).
25 - updated libecb.

274.20 Sat Jun 20 13:01:43 CEST 2015
28 - prefer noexcept over throw () with C++ 11.
29 - update ecb.h due to incompatibilities with c11.
30 - fix a potential aliasing issue when reading and writing
31 watcher callbacks.
32
334.19 Thu Sep 25 08:18:25 CEST 2014
34 - ev.h wasn't valid C++ anymore, which tripped compilers other than
35 clang, msvc or gcc (analyzed by Raphael 'kena' Poss). Unfortunately,
36 C++ doesn't support typedefs for function pointers fully, so the affected
37 declarations have to spell out the types each time.
38 - when not using autoconf, tighten the check for clock_gettime and related
39 functionality.
40
414.18 Fri Sep 5 17:55:26 CEST 2014
42 - events on files were not always generated properly with the
43 epoll backend (testcase by Assaf Inbal).
44 - mark event pipe fd as cloexec after a fork (analyzed by Sami Farin).
45 - (ecb) support m68k, m88k and sh (patch by Miod Vallat).
46 - use a reasonable fallback for EV_NSIG instead of erroring out
47 when we can't detect the signal set size.
48 - in the absence of autoconf, do not use the clock syscall
49 on glibc >= 2.17 (avoids the syscall AND -lrt on systems
50 doing clock_gettime in userspace).
51 - ensure extern "C" function pointers are used for externally-visible
52 loop callbacks (not watcher callbacks yet).
53 - (ecb) work around memory barriers and volatile apparently both being
54 broken in visual studio 2008 and later (analysed and patch by Nicolas Noble).
55
564.15 Fri Mar 1 12:04:50 CET 2013
57 - destroying a non-default loop would stop the global waitpid
58 watcher (Denis Bilenko).
59 - queueing pending watchers of higher priority from a watcher now invokes
60 them in a timely fashion (reported by Denis Bilenko).
61 - add throw() to all libev functions that cannot throw exceptions, for
62 further code size decrease when compiling for C++.
63 - add throw () to callbacks that must not throw exceptions (allocator,
64 syserr, loop acquire/release, periodic reschedule cbs).
65 - fix event_base_loop return code, add event_get_callback, event_base_new,
66 event_base_get_method calls to improve libevent 1.x emulation and add
67 some libevent 2.x functionality (based on a patch by Jeff Davey).
68 - add more memory fences to fix a bug reported by Jeff Davey. Better
69 be overfenced than underprotected.
70 - ev_run now returns a boolean status (true meaning watchers are
71 still active).
72 - ev_once: undef EV_ERROR in ev_kqueue.c, to avoid clashing with
73 libev's EV_ERROR (reported by 191919).
74 - (ecb) add memory fence support for xlC (Darin McBride).
75 - (ecb) add memory fence support for gcc-mips (Anton Kirilov).
76 - (ecb) add memory fence support for gcc-alpha (Christian Weisgerber).
77 - work around some kernels losing file descriptors by leaking
78 the kqueue descriptor in the child.
79 - work around linux inotify not reporting IN_ATTRIB changes for directories
80 in many cases.
81 - include sys/syscall.h instead of plain syscall.h.
82 - check for io watcher loops in ev_verify, check for the most
83 common reported usage bug in ev_io_start.
84 - choose socket vs. WSASocket at compiletime using EV_USE_WSASOCKET.
85 - always use WSASend/WSARecv directly on windows, hoping that this
86 works in all cases (unlike read/write/send/recv...).
87 - try to detect signals around a fork faster (test program by
88 Denis Bilenko).
89 - work around recent glibc versions that leak memory in realloc.
90 - rename ev::embed::set to ev::embed::set_embed to avoid clashing
91 the watcher base set (loop) method.
92 - rewrite the async/signal pipe logic to always keep a valid fd, which
93 simplifies (and hopefully correctifies :) the race checking
94 on fork, at the cost of one extra fd.
95 - add fat, msdos, jffs2, ramfs, ntfs and btrfs to the list of
96 inotify-supporting filesystems.
97 - move orig_CFLAGS assignment to after AC_INIT, as newer autoconf
98 versions ignore it before
99 (https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=908096).
100 - add some untested android support.
101 - enum expressions must be of type int (reported by Juan Pablo L).

1034.11 Sat Feb 4 19:52:39 CET 2012
104 - INCOMPATIBLE CHANGE: ev_timer_again now clears the pending status, as
105 was documented already, but not implemented in the repeating case.
106 - new compiletime symbols: EV_NO_SMP and EV_NO_THREADS.
107 - fix a race where the workaround against the epoll fork bugs
108 caused signals to not be handled anymore.
109 - correct backend_fudge for most backends, and implement a windows
110 specific workaround to avoid looping because we call both
111 select and Sleep, both with different time resolutions.
112 - document range and guarantees of ev_sleep.
113 - document reasonable ranges for periodics interval and offset.
114 - rename backend_fudge to backend_mintime to avoid future confusion :)
115 - change the default periodic reschedule function to hopefully be more
116 exact and correct even in corner cases or in the far future.
117 - do not rely on -lm anymore: use it when available but use our
118 own floor () if it is missing. This should make it easier to embed,
119 as no external libraries are required.
120 - strategically import macros from libecb and mark rarely-used functions
121 as cache-cold (saving almost 2k code size on typical amd64 setups).
122 - add Symbols.ev and Symbols.event files, that were missing.
123 - fix backend_mintime value for epoll (was 1/1024, is 1/1000 now).
124 - fix #3 "be smart about timeouts" to not "deadlock" when
125 timeout == now, also improve the section overall.
126 - avoid "AVOIDING FINISHING BEFORE RETURNING" idiom.
127 - support new EV_API_STATIC mode to make all libev symbols
128 static.
129 - supply default CFLAGS of -g -O3 with gcc when original CFLAGS
130 were empty.

1324.04 Wed Feb 16 09:01:51 CET 2011
133 - fix two problems in the native win32 backend, where reuse of fd's
134 with different underlying handles caused handles not to be removed
135 or added to the select set (analyzed and tested by Bert Belder).
136 - do no rely on ceil() in ev_e?poll.c.
137 - backport libev to HP-UX versions before 11 v3.
138 - configure did not detect nanosleep and clock_gettime properly when
139 they are available in the libc (as opposed to -lrt).
140
1414.03 Tue Jan 11 14:37:25 CET 2011
142 - officially support polling files with all backends.
143 - support files, /dev/zero etc. the same way as select in the epoll
144 backend, by generating events on our own.
145 - ports backend: work around solaris bug 6874410 and many related ones
146 (EINTR, maybe more), with no performance loss (note that the solaris
147 bug report is actually wrong, reality is far more bizarre and broken
148 than that).
149 - define EV_READ/EV_WRITE as macros in event.h, as some programs use
150 #ifdef to test for them.
151 - new (experimental) function: ev_feed_signal.
152 - new (to become default) EVFLAG_NOSIGMASK flag.
153 - new EVBACKEND_MASK symbol.
154 - updated COMMON IDIOMS SECTION.

1644.00 Mon Oct 25 12:32:12 CEST 2010
165 - "PORTING FROM LIBEV 3.X TO 4.X" (in ev.pod) is recommended reading.
166 - ev_embed_stop did not correctly stop the watcher (very good
167 testcase by Vladimir Timofeev).
168 - ev_run will now always update the current loop time - it erroneously
169 didn't when idle watchers were active, causing timers not to fire.
170 - fix a bug where a timeout of zero caused the timer not to fire
171 in the libevent emulation (testcase by Péter Szabó).
172 - applied win32 fixes by Michael Lenaghan (also James Mansion).
173 - replace EV_MINIMAL by EV_FEATURES.
174 - prefer EPOLL_CTL_ADD over EPOLL_CTL_MOD in some more cases, as it
175 seems the former is *much* faster than the latter.
176 - linux kernel version detection (for inotify bug workarounds)
177 did not work properly.
178 - reduce the number of spurious wake-ups with the ports backend.
179 - remove dependency on sys/queue.h on freebsd (patch by Vanilla Hsu).
180 - do async init within ev_async_start, not ev_async_set, which avoids
181 an API quirk where the set function must be called in the C++ API
182 even when there is nothing to set.
183 - add (undocumented) EV_ENABLE when adding events with kqueue,
184 this might help with OS X, which seems to need it despite documenting
185 not to need it (helpfully pointed out by Tilghman Lesher).
186 - do not use poll by default on freebsd, it's broken (what isn't
187 on freebsd...).
188 - allow to embed epoll on kernels >= 2.6.32.
189 - configure now prepends -O3, not appends it, so one can still
190 override it.
191 - ev.pod: greatly expanded the portability section, added a porting
192 section, a description of watcher states and made lots of minor fixes.
193 - disable poll backend on AIX, the poll header spams the namespace
194 and it's not worth working around dead platforms (reported
195 and analyzed by Aivars Kalvans).
196 - improve header file compatibility of the standalone eventfd code
197 in an obscure case.
198 - implement EV_AVOID_STDIO option.
199 - do not use sscanf to parse linux version number (smaller, faster,
200 no sscanf dependency).
201 - new EV_CHILD_ENABLE and EV_SIGNAL_ENABLE configurable settings.
202 - update libev.m4 HAVE_CLOCK_SYSCALL test for newer glibcs.
203 - add section on accept() problems to the manpage.
204 - rename EV_TIMEOUT to EV_TIMER.
205 - rename ev_loop_count/depth/verify/loop/unloop.
206 - remove ev_default_destroy and ev_default_fork.
207 - switch to two-digit minor version.
208 - work around an apparent gentoo compiler bug.
209 - define _DARWIN_UNLIMITED_SELECT. just so.
210 - use enum instead of #define for most constants.
211 - improve compatibility to older C++ compilers.
212 - (experimental) ev_run/ev_default_loop/ev_break/ev_loop_new have now
213 default arguments when compiled as C++.
214 - enable automake dependency tracking.
215 - ev_loop_new no longer leaks memory when loop creation failed.
216 - new ev_cleanup watcher type.

2183.9 Thu Dec 31 07:59:59 CET 2009
219 - signalfd is no longer used by default and has to be requested
220 explicitly - this means that easy to catch bugs become hard to
221 catch race conditions, but the users have spoken.
222 - point out the unspecified signal mask in the documentation, and
223 that this is a race condition regardless of EV_SIGNALFD.
224 - backport inotify code to C89.
225 - inotify file descriptors could leak into child processes.
226 - ev_stat watchers could keep an erroneous extra ref on the loop,
227 preventing exit when unregistering all watchers (testcases
228 provided by ry@tinyclouds.org).
229 - implement EV_WIN32_HANDLE_TO_FD and EV_WIN32_CLOSE_FD configuration
230 symbols to make it easier for apps to do their own fd management.
231 - support EV_IDLE_ENABLE being disabled in ev++.h
232 (patch by Didier Spezia).
233 - take advantage of inotify_init1, if available, to set cloexec/nonblock
234 on fd creation, to avoid races.
235 - the signal handling pipe wasn't always initialised under windows
236 (analysed by lekma).
237 - changed minimum glibc requirement from glibc 2.9 to 2.7, for
238 signalfd.
239 - add missing string.h include (Denis F. Latypoff).
240 - only replace ev_stat.prev when we detect an actual difference,
241 so prev is (almost) always different to attr. this might
242 have caused the problems with 04_stat.t.
243 - add ev::timer->remaining () method to C++ API.
244
2453.8 Sun Aug 9 14:30:45 CEST 2009
246 - incompatible change: do not necessarily reset signal handler
247 to SIG_DFL when a sighandler is stopped.
248 - ev_default_destroy did not properly free or zero some members,
249 potentially causing crashes and memory corruption on repeated
250 ev_default_destroy/ev_default_loop calls.
251 - take advantage of signalfd on GNU/Linux systems.
252 - document that the signal mask might be in an unspecified
253 state when using libev's signal handling.
254 - take advantage of some GNU/Linux calls to set cloexec/nonblock
255 on fd creation, to avoid race conditions.
256
2573.7 Fri Jul 17 16:36:32 CEST 2009
258 - ev_unloop and ev_loop wrongly used a global variable to exit loops,
259 instead of using a per-loop variable (bug caught by accident...).
260 - the ev_set_io_collect_interval interpretation has changed.
261 - add new functionality: ev_set_userdata, ev_userdata,
262 ev_set_invoke_pending_cb, ev_set_loop_release_cb,
263 ev_invoke_pending, ev_pending_count, together with a long example
264 about thread locking.
265 - add ev_timer_remaining (as requested by Denis F. Latypoff).
266 - add ev_loop_depth.
267 - calling ev_unloop in fork/prepare watchers will no longer poll
268 for new events.
269 - Denis F. Latypoff corrected many typos in example code snippets.
270 - honor autoconf detection of EV_USE_CLOCK_SYSCALL, also double-
271 check that the syscall number is available before trying to
272 use it (reported by ry@tinyclouds).
273 - use GetSystemTimeAsFileTime instead of _timeb on windows, for
274 slightly higher accuracy.
275 - properly declare ev_loop_verify and ev_now_update even when
276 !EV_MULTIPLICITY.
277 - do not compile in any priority code when EV_MAXPRI == EV_MINPRI.
278 - support EV_MINIMAL==2 for a reduced API.
279 - actually 0-initialise struct sigaction when installing signals.
280 - add section on hibernate and stopped processes to ev_timer docs.
281
2823.6 Tue Apr 28 02:49:30 CEST 2009
283 - multiple timers becoming ready within an event loop iteration
284 will be invoked in the "correct" order now.
285 - do not leave the event loop early just because we have no active
286 watchers, fixing a problem when embedding a kqueue loop
287 that has active kernel events but no registered watchers
288 (reported by blacksand blacksand).
289 - correctly zero the idx values for arrays, so destroying and
290 reinitialising the default loop actually works (patch by
291 Malek Hadj-Ali).
292 - implement ev_suspend and ev_resume.
293 - new EV_CUSTOM revents flag for use by applications.
294 - add documentation section about priorities.
295 - add a glossary to the documentation.
296 - extend the ev_fork description slightly.
297 - optimize a jump out of call_pending.
